  • this look awesome. can you tell me what is that pinkish dish at the left side?

  • Thank you for your comment.

    That pinkish dish at the left side is Beetroot Pachadi aka Beetroot Raitha.

    Grated Cooked Beetroot + Beaten Yoghurt + Chopped Shallots + Salt + Cumin Powder + Chopped Fresh Coriander Leaves = Mix well = Serve chilled
